
Bravus awards $40m to local Queensland businesses
Bravus Mining and Resources has awarded two contracts for the construction of a new heavy vehicle maintenance workshop at its Carmichael mine in central Queensland. Family-owned Cairns business CSF Steel Fabricators has been commissioned to fabricate and then freight more than 685t of structural steel to the mine. The steel will be used by Hawkins Group to construct the 5,700m2 Mine Industrial Area workshop and warehouse.
